Broyhill Asset Management, a Charlotte-based firm, issued its second-quarter 2026 investor letter, which is available for download here. The Broyhill Equity Composite gained 8.8% in Q2, trailing the MSCI All Country World Index's 15.1% and the MSCI ACWI Value Index's 10.8%. For the first half, the Composite returned 2.3%, versus 11.5% for the Index.

The letter highlights that a significant portion of the shortfall occurred in April due to market dynamics and geopolitical events, with tech, particularly semiconductors, driving recent gains. Broyhill notes its lack of direct semiconductor exposure but acknowledges potential interest in the sector if opportunities arise, maintaining its investment philosophy focused on capital protection in fragile market conditions. In its second-quarter 2026 investor letter, Broyhill Asset Management highlighted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S).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S), a US-based home improvement and building products manufacturer, contributed positively to performance this quarter. On September 14, 2026,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) closed at $69.41 per share.

Over the past month,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) declined 5.41%, but its shares are down 5.31% over the past year.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) has a market capitalization of $13.69 billion, and its stock has traded within a 52-week range of $58.16 to $83.64. Broyhill Asset Management stated the following regarding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) in its Q2 2026 investor letter: "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) gained 37%, the best result in the portfolio, and was initiated in the first quarter as one of two investments in the depressed housing sector.

The quarter was plumbing-led and, more to the point, volume-led, with the strongest volume growth since the end of the pandemic and pricing intact. Management raised the topline outlook, took out delayed-draw leverage to repurchase stock, and increased the buyback guide by $200 million, to more than $800 million against a $2 billion authorization. Earlier in the quarter, our investment team also attended Masco's investor day and was able to interact with management at the event."
